Mahmoud Al-Batal, Kristen Brustad, Abbas Al-Tonsi, "Alif Baa: Introduction to Arabic Letters and Sounds"



Georgetown Univ Press | August 1995 | 224 pages | PDF | 11.4MB

With a set of three audio CDs, this text is intended for anyone interested in learning modern Arabic as a living language. The first part of the Al-Kitaab language program, it embodies two main premises: that the student can and should learn to recognize and produce the sounds of Arabic correctly from the very beginning, and that the student should be introduced to the full range of the Arabic language and cultural continuum - colloquial, modern standard, and classical. In teaching the sounds and letters of Arabic, this text provides a variety of exercises aimed at developing all skills: reading, listening, writing, speaking, and cultural understanding.
